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newtongrange to Tutbury & Hatton start from as little as £66.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Newtongrange to Tutbury & Hatton start from £127.20 one way, or £181.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newtongrange to Tutbury & Hatton are available for £128.20 one way, or £256.40 return

Facilities and Amenities at Newtongrange Station

Visitors to Newtongrange Train Station will find a range of fac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. While there is no tra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available on-site to purchase or collect tickets, making the travel experience seamless. For those who utilize smartcards, validators are conveniently present at the station. The station offers step-free access throughout, ensuring it is user-friendly for all travelers. Additionally, there are sheltered bicycle stands and CCTV for added security, making cycling a convenient option for getting to and from the station.

Although Newtongrange lacks certain amenities such as toilets, eateries, and shops, the station compensates with practical alternatives. There is a sheltered waiting area on the platform for travelers awaiting their train. The installation of public Wi-Fi keeps you connected to the digital world, and an induction loop is available for those who require hearing assistance. The absence of staff assistance is mitigated by comprehensive customer help points and useful online resources.

Onward Travel from Newtongrange

Newtongrange Station connects seamlessly to other transportation modes, making onward travel a breeze. For those seeking alternatives to rail, local bus services operate from the main road (A7) at the station entrance. For precise location details or queries on specific bus services, visiting Traveline Scotland or calling their 24-hour helpline is recommended. If taxi services are more desirable, you can access nearby taxi hire services through Train Taxi for a reliable onward journey.

Facilities and Amenities at Tutbury & Hatton Station

While Tutbury & Hatton may not boast all the grand facilities of a metropolitan station, it serves its purpose well for those embarking on their travels. Unfortunately, there isn’t a dedicated ticket office, but travelers can conveniently purchase their tickets from machines available onsite. While you can't collect tickets that were bought online, smartcard validators are present for those traveling using this method.

For those seeking assistance, the station features customer help points, and a help point where staff are available to provide guidance. CCTV ensures safety throughout your visit. However, you might want to plan ahead for certain needs as there are no waiting rooms, seating areas, or refreshment facilities onsite. Also, those with accessibility needs should note that while the areas have some step-free access, there is no tactile paving on the platforms and features like accessible toilets or ramps for train access aren't available.

Onward Travel Options

Despite the compact size of Tutbury & Hatton, it connects seamlessly with other modes of transport. In the event of rail service replacements, travelers can catch a bus at the Station Road bus stop.
